Our Community Stepped Up in a Big Way

Oct 3, 2022

As of Friday, September 30 we had 610 animals on campus. Our shelter population is moving closer to a manageable level. This is great news! We put out a call for help, and you answered. Since Monday, 239 animals have been placed in foster homes. We are so grateful for the community’s response. We’re excited to say adoptions resumed Friday, September 30. Adoptable Pets Who Just Had Their Teeth Cleaned

Mar 15, 2022

Pets on this page just had their teeth cleaned by veterinary dental specialist Dr. Brook Niemien and his team from Veterinary Dental Specialties & Oral Surgery. Dental work can be an expensive part of pet ownership, sometimes costing thousands of dollars if extractions are required. While dental care for your pet is a lifelong commitment and we recommend follow-up care with your full service vet, it's still a huge bonus that the dogs' teeth on this page are currently in tip-top shape!
